Details | Sensoji Temple, Sanja Matsuri, Matsuchiyama, Hanakawado... Asakusa is one of Tokyo's leading entertainment districts, retaining a strong Edo atmosphere. Ozashiki-asobi, where you enjoy blissful times with geisha while savoring food and drinks, is a top-class form of entertainment for adults that flourished during the Edo period. It is an art form that has been passed down through the generations of Asakusa geisha, who are full of love for their hometown. The art of the hokan who liven up the ozashiki is now only inherited in the Asakusa entertainment district. The Asakusa Dance allows you to enjoy all of these things at once.
